Output 8e0fd43cefc33df07ca2c4b567fc520b9b0cf159ee4036aa35e270f397d0d73a:0

value
158823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533c5f8331ea78a0139acc3f262fb23d4e78ce97 OP_EQUAL
address
39H8LG9Hybgcj4ND4Ls6VdcRux5J9PiZNW
transaction
8e0fd43cefc33df07ca2c4b567fc520b9b0cf159ee4036aa35e270f397d0d73a
confirmations
160247
spent
true